Daniel Porter (born 13 February 1992), known professionally as Daniel Portman, is a Scottish actor. He appeared in the 2010 movie Outcast and has a role in the upcoming 2012 film The Angels' Share.

Portman initially wanted to be a professional rugby player until he broke his leg in a match when he was 16 years old. [1] He studied acting at the Paisley Reid Kerr College.

In Game of Thrones he is playing the role of Podrick Payne. He was announced in the role on 24 August 2011.[2] He joined the cast as a guest star in the second season.

After getting hooked on the TV series after Season 1, Portman read the entire novel series. Subsequently he was cast as Podrick starting in Season 2. In the books, Podrick does appear in the first novel, being introduced in the Lannister army camp prior to the Battle of the Green Fork (corresponding to the episode "Baelor"). Podrick's first on-screen appearance was pushed back to the beginning of Season 2, though his background may not have been changed - in that he might simply have been "off-screen" in the Lannister camp during Season 1.

Daniel's father, Ron Donachie also appeared on the series as Rodrik Cassel in Season 1 and Season 2.[3]
